Overview

Finite Geometry and Combinatorics is the art of counting any phenomena that can be described by a diagram. Everyday life is full of applications: from telephones to compact disc players, from the transmission of confidential information to the codes on any item on supermarket shelves. This is a collection of 35 articles on covering topics such as finite projective spaces, generalised polygons, strongly regular graphs, diagram geometries and polar spaces. Included here are articles from many of the leading practitioners in the field, including, for the first time, several distinguished Russian mathematicians. Many of the papers contain important new results, and the growing use of computer algebra packages in this area is also demonstrated.
